Key Insights
The South American Halal food and beverage market, valued at approximately $XX million in 2025, is projected to experience robust growth, driven by a rising Muslim population, increasing awareness of Halal certification, and a growing preference for healthier and ethically sourced food products. The market's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 3.10% from 2025 to 2033 indicates a steady expansion, with significant potential for further acceleration due to evolving consumer preferences and expanding distribution networks. Key growth drivers include the increasing popularity of Halal-certified processed foods, a surge in demand for convenient Halal meal options, and the burgeoning tourism sector, which fuels demand for Halal food services. Brazil, Argentina, and other South American nations are witnessing increased investment in Halal food processing and infrastructure, further propelling market growth. The segmentation reveals a strong focus on Halal food products, with Halal beverages and supplements also contributing significantly to overall market value. Hypermarkets and supermarkets currently dominate the distribution channels, but increasing online presence and expansion into specialty and convenience stores is anticipated. Leading players like Nestle SA, BRF SA, and Marfrig Global Foods are strategically positioning themselves to capitalize on this expanding market, while smaller local businesses contribute significantly to the overall sector.
The market's growth, however, is not without challenges. Regulatory hurdles and the need for stronger Halal certification standards could act as restraints. Consumer education about the benefits and authenticity of Halal products remains crucial for fostering wider adoption. Furthermore, maintaining consistent supply chain management, especially for sourcing raw materials and ensuring adherence to strict Halal guidelines, poses a significant challenge to market expansion. Despite these challenges, the long-term outlook remains positive, fueled by the growing Muslim population, increasing disposable incomes, and a shift towards health-conscious and ethically produced food choices. Successful market players will need to emphasize transparency, quality assurance, and effective marketing strategies to connect with the target demographic and capture a larger market share. Investment in research and development of innovative Halal food and beverage products will also be crucial for sustained growth and differentiation.

Key Markets & Segments Leading South America Halal Food & Beverages Market
Brazil emerges as the dominant market within South America, owing to its large Muslim population and robust food processing industry. Other significant markets include Argentina and Colombia. Within the product segments, Halal food dominates the market, driven by strong demand for staples like meat, poultry, and dairy. Halal beverages, including juices and soft drinks, are also witnessing rapid growth. The Halal supplements segment is a niche market with promising growth potential. Distribution channels are diversifying, with hypermarkets/supermarkets maintaining a significant share, followed by specialty stores catering to specific dietary needs. Convenience stores are gaining traction due to their accessibility.
